DACx300x Ultra-Low-Power DACs
Texas Instruments DACx300x Ultra-Low-Power Digital-to-Analog Converters (DACs) are 12 or 10-bit ultra-low-power, single-channel and dual-channel, buffered voltage-output and current-output smart DACs. The DACx300x devices support Hi-Z power-down mode and Hi-Z output during power-off conditions. The DAC outputs provide a force-sense option for use as a programmable comparator and current sink. The multifunction GPIO, function generation, and NVM enable these smart DACs for processor-less applications and design reuse. These devices automatically detect I2C, PMBus, and SPI interfaces and contain an internal reference.
